University of Utah College of Nursing
About
The University of Utah College of Nursing in Salt Lake City provides a comprehensive Registered Nurse program that blends classroom learning with extensive clinical experiences. This program is tailored for students seeking a thorough understanding of nursing principles and hands-on practice in real healthcare settings. Graduates can expect to be well-prepared for the NCLEX-RN exam and to enter the nursing field with a strong skill set.

Training Programs
The College of Nursing offers a Registered Nurse program that emphasizes evidence-based practice, patient-centered care, and interdisciplinary collaboration. Students engage in both theoretical coursework and practical clinical training in diverse healthcare environments.
